Environment

  • macOS Catalina 10.15.5, using an account having the administrator privileges
  • CLI: 7.0.11 (iOS and Android setup)
  • Your current package manager is npm 6.14.8
  • XCode Version: 12.2 (12B45b)

Describe the bug, runtime error
(I think) I followed the macOS install procedure. I somehow ended-up with a missing
/usr/local/lib/node_modules/nativescript/docs/html system directory.

To Reproduce
Run ns help when the /usr/local/lib/node_modules/nativescript/docs/html system directory is missing.
EACCES: permission denied, mkdir '/usr/local/lib/node_modules/nativescript/docs/html'

Expected behavior
Check for relevant credentials before executing the mkdir command, and propose to run using sudo to work arround this issue.

Sample project
Not required

Additional context
Similar to: #3694
